A Temporary Madness
It's a temporary madness
A blinding, crippled stare
Waiting to hold us captive
To all of us who dare
It has no rhyme or reason
It doesn't care who we are
It's painful without purpose
And always leaves a scar
We never learn our lesson
We fall into its snare
No matter where we go in life
It's waiting for us there
It's stronger than addiction
We'll always need our fix
To some, it's just a game they play
It's how they get their kicks
It's the oldest form of emotion
That's known to modern man
No one has escaped it
And no one ever can
This thing I've been describing
Is a gift from God above
It's known to all, as just one word
This thing that we call "Love"
